Shipside Hydraulic Watertight Pilot Door | Flush Folding Shell Door
Product Overview
The shipside hydraulic watertight pilot door is a flush-closing shell opening used to provide a controlled passage between the pilot boarding position and the vessel interior. The assembly is normally integrated into the side shell within the approved pilot transfer arrangement and may be supplied as port and starboard units where the vessel design requires boarding access on both sides.
The supplied PWTD arrangement combines a bi-fold door body, hydraulic cylinders, hydraulic power unit, locking cleats, resilient sealing gasket, and a pilot ladder stowage reel. In the closed position, the external surface is arranged flush with the surrounding shell plating. During boarding, the door opens inboard, folds to reduce its stowed envelope, and is mechanically secured clear of the access route. Final design must coordinate shell reinforcement, door loads, sealing pressure, hydraulic controls, pilot ladder securing points, safe handholds, alarms, emergency operation, and class approval.

Selection & Inquiry Guide
Step 1: Confirm the door location, port or starboard orientation, freeboard-deck relationship, sill height, access deck level, design draughts, trim conditions, and pilot boat approach area.
Step 2: Select the clear opening from PWTD1 to PWTD5 and verify compliance with the applicable pilot transfer rules. For projects subject to IMO resolution MSC.576(110), the side opening requires at least 2,200 mm clear height and 915 mm clear width.
Step 3: Provide the shell structure and installation drawing showing opening compensation, rounded corners, frames, stringers, foundation structure, adjacent bulkhead, drainage, and available folding / ladder-reel stowage space.
Step 4: Confirm the hydraulic scope: local control, remote control, open / closed indication, cleat or locking indication, emergency manual operation, power supply, hydraulic pressure, environmental rating, and control philosophy.
Step 5: Confirm material, gasket, corrosion-protection system, weld details, cleat arrangement, anti-piracy or security locking requirement, ladder reel, handholds, strong points, lighting, and any project-specific interlocks.
Step 6: Confirm watertight test pressure or head, hose / air / chalk test requirements, hydraulic circuit testing, functional test, class witnessing, certificate scope, quantity, destination, and required delivery time.

How It Works
Confirm safe boarding condition → Release locking cleats in the approved sequence → Hydraulic cylinders open and fold the door inboard → Secure the folded leaf in the open position → Rig and independently secure the pilot ladder and access equipment → Complete pilot transfer → Recover and stow the ladder → Unsecure, unfold, and close the door → Engage cleats uniformly → Confirm closed and locked indication

FAQ
Q1: Which PWTD sizes are suitable for future IMO pilot-transfer requirements?
A1: IMO resolution MSC.576(110) specifies a minimum shipside opening clearance of 2,200 mm in height and 915 mm in width for arrangements within its application. PWTD2 to PWTD5 exceed this minimum based on the supplied clear dimensions. PWTD1 has a 2,000 mm clear height and therefore requires project-specific review for installation date, vessel applicability, flag Administration, class, and the approved arrangement.
Q2: Does the hydraulic ladder reel support the pilot ladder while personnel are boarding?
A2: No. The reel is used for storage and controlled handling. During transfer, the pilot ladder must be secured to independent approved strong points, and the access route must remain unobstructed. The reel, door edges, hinges, and other fittings must not introduce chafing, pinching, or unsafe bends.
Q3: What tests should be specified for a shipside hydraulic watertight pilot door?
A3: The purchase specification should separate structural and watertight testing from hydraulic-system and functional testing. Typical agreed checks may include material and welding inspection, dimensional inspection, hydraulic circuit pressure and leakage testing, opening / folding / closing sequence tests, emergency-operation tests, position-indication tests, gasket contact checks, and the class-required hose, air, or pressure test. Fire and gas-tightness tests apply only to separately approved performance configurations.
